Web6 okt. 2024 · For some appliances, you can look at the data tag and calculate the running watts required to power the device. To calculate the operating wattage, multiply the amperage by the voltage. For a microwave that requires 13.4A and 120V, the operating wattage would be 1,608 watts. Resistive vs. Reactive Loads

Standard microwaves have a wattage between 850 and 1,800 watts for medium to large models. Compact microwaves use 500 to 800 watts, and commercial microwaves can exceed 2,500 watts.
